LOCAL GOVERNMENT ACT 1993 - SECT 254A

Circumstances in which annual fees may be withheld

254A Circumstances in which annual fees may be withheld

(1) Despite this Division, a council may resolve that an annual fee will not be paid to a councillor or that a councillor will be paid a reduced annual fee determined by the council--
(a) for any period of not more than 3 months for which the councillor is absent, with or without leave, from an ordinary meeting or ordinary meetings of the council, or
(b) in any other circumstances prescribed by the regulations.
(2) Despite this Division, if a councillor is absent, with or without leave of the council, from ordinary meetings of the council for any period of more than 3 months, the council must not pay any annual fee, or part of an annual fee, to that councillor that relates to the period of absence that is in excess of 3 months.
